Ladies Stunned In Final Seconds At Home By LeTourneau

Shreveport - The Centenary women's soccer team suffered a gut-wrenching 2-1 loss to the LeTourneau University YellowJackets on Sunday evening in a non-conference contest at Mayo Field.

The Ladies (0-6-1) led 1-0 with just under seven minutes remaining but the visitors stunned them with a pair of goals, including the game-winning score with just 12 seconds remaining to record the improbable victory. Letourneau improved to 2-1-2 with the win.

Centenary took a 1-0 lead when junior D Alexa Hinojosa (Pasadena, Texas) was fouled inside the box and earned a penalty kick. She rifled the ball into the net past LeTourneau goalkeeper Kiersten Reeser, her second goal this season and fourth of her career. That one-goal lead appeared as if it would be enough to give the Ladies their first win of the season, but Terra Tucker's goal in the 84th minute tied the match and six minutes later with the final seconds of the clock ticking in regulation, Heather Fellows scored to give the YellowJackets the win.

The Ladies, despite still being winless this season, have been very close to breaking through within the last week. The Maroon and White fell 2-1 on Friday night at St. Thomas Celts in a Southern Collegiate Athletic Conference contest in Houston and earned a hard-fought 0-0 tie with the Belhaven University Blazers on Tuesday in Jackson, Miss.

LeTourneau finished with a 16-7 advantage in shots, including a decisive 10-2 edge in the second half. The Ladies took three corner kicks to the YellowJackets' one. Sixteen fouls were called in the match and three yellow cards were issued. Sophomore GK Madison Ersoff (Shreveport, La.) played all 90 minutes and recorded five saves while Reeser also went the distance and made two saves.
